Job Summary:

The Bucks IU Behavior Analysts have the primary responsibility of providing high quality services in the areas of functional behavioral assessment, positive behavior support, verbal behavior, discrete trial, data collection and data analysis, classroom consultation, and staff training. The Behavior Analyst is responsible for implementing evidence-based practices to address complex learning and behavioral needs of students. The Bucks IU Behavior Analysts work in IU programs and are available to work directly in assigned districts within Bucks County.

Essential Functions:

  • Conduct functional assessments (FBA) (indirect and direct measures)
  • Prescribe positive behavior support plans based on FBA
  • Prescribe feasible systems of progress monitoring
  • Provide staff training and consultation on prescribed interventions and/or progress monitoring
  • Modeling and feedback of prescribed procedures
  • Provide routine consultation on a mutually agreeable schedule with the classroom teacher in accordance with the IEP (Individualized Education Plan)
  • Attendance at IEP’s for students with PBSP’s (Positive Behavior Support Plan)
  • Assist classroom staff with summarizing progress monitoring data as needed for progress reports and IEP’s

Qualifications

Education and Experience:

  • Bachelor’s Degree from accredited college or university required.
  • Master’s Degree preferred.
  • Board Certified Behavior Analyst certificate through BACB or hold a current license for Behavior Specialist in the State of Pennsylvania required.
  • BACB Behavior Analyst Supervisor Certification or willingness to earn this credential (required to supervise Registered Behavior Technicians).
